How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Cope?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Cope Studio Apartments | $1,307 | $849 | $2,060 |
| Cope 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,338 | $828 | $2,863 |
| Cope 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,399 | $805 | $3,859 |
| Cope 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,248 | $679 | $2,534 |
| Cope 4 Bedroom Apartments | $703 | $609 | $820 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Cope
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Cope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Cope ranges from $828 to $2,863 with an average monthly rent of $1,338.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Cope c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Cope range from $805 to $3,859.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,399.
How expensive are Cope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 32 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Cope on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$679 to $2,534 - averaging $1,248 for the location.
